Tracy Byrd - A Look at His Life and Music
Tracy Lynn Byrd, born on December 17, 1966, is, as a matter of fact, a well-known American country music artist. His journey in music began when he signed with MCA Nashville Records in 1992. That year, he truly stepped into the spotlight of the country music world. His arrival, you know, signaled a fresh voice in the genre, someone who would soon become a favorite for many listeners. Personal Details of Tracy Byrd
Here are some basic facts about Tracy Byrd, which might give you a little more insight into the artist:
Full Name | Tracy Lynn Byrd |
Date of Birth | December 17, 1966 |
Nationality | American |
Occupation | Country Music Artist, Singer |
Record Label Debut | MCA Nashville Records (1992) |

Some of his most famous works include "Ten Rounds with Jose Cuervo," which, frankly, became a huge hit and a party favorite. Then there's "Watermelon Crawl," a song that just makes you want to get up and move, you know? "Holdin' Heaven" is another one that many people remember fondly, a tune with a really tender side. And, of course, "The Keeper of the Stars" is a classic, showcasing his ability to deliver a heartfelt ballad.
